BÖHLER FOX KE

Rutile-cellulosic stick electrode, unalloyed

Classification
EN ISO 2560-A EN ISO 2560-B AWS A5.1 AWS A5.1M
E 38 0 RC 1 1 E4313 A E6013 E4313

Characteristics and typical fields of application


Rutile-cellulosic coated electrode engineered for easy operating in all positions including vertical-
down.
Excellent welding properties on A.C., good striking and restriking characteristics, sound
penetration, flat beads; popular for general steel construction.

Base materials
Steels up to a yield strength of 380 MPa (52 Ksi)
S235JR-S355JR, S235JO-S355JO, P195TR1-P265TR1, P195GH-P265GH, L245NB-L360NB,
L245MB-L360MB. Ship building steels: A, B, D
ASTM A 106, Gr. A, B; A 283 Gr. A, C; A 285 Gr. A, B, C; A 501, Gr. B; A 573, Gr. 58, 65; A 633,
Gr. A, C; A 711 Gr. 1013; API 5 L Gr. B, X42, X52
